Observe heat signatures in darkness, fog, smoke, and visually challenging outdoor environments with the TRV TRX335 Thermal Imaging Scope. Featuring a 384 × 288 thermal detector, 12 μm pixel pitch, 35 mm objective lens, and thermal sensitivity of 20 mK or lower, this device is designed for detailed long-distance thermal observation.

The TRX335 includes an integrated laser rangefinder with a listed measuring distance of up to 1,200 metres, a ballistic-calculation function, one-shot zeroing, video recording, and multilingual menu support. Its IPX7-rated housing and listed 800G impact resistance support use in demanding outdoor conditions, subject to verified test documentation.

Magnification

The listed magnification range is 3–12x.

Digital zoom enlarges the displayed image but does not increase the sensor’s native resolution. Visible detail may decrease at higher zoom settings.

Thermal Detection Range

The scope provides a listed detection range of up to approximately 1,800 m.

Detection means that a heat source may be visible. It does not necessarily mean that the subject can be recognized or positively identified at that distance.

Important Use Information

Avoid pointing the thermal detector directly at the sun, lasers, welding arcs, or other intense energy sources, as these may damage the sensor.

Use and installation must comply with the manufacturer’s instructions and all applicable local laws.

Keep the lens clean and dry, protect the device during transport, and inspect the housing, controls, battery, lens, and mounting components before use.
